NDRF conducts awareness programme

ITANAGAR, Nov 30: The 12th battalion of NDRF based at Doimuikh and Hollongi on Friday conducted mass awareness programme on how to react during emergency like earthquake, landslide, flood and other natural disasters. The personnel conducted mock drill and rescue exercises here at the premises of RK Mission Hospital.
The programme was held under the supervision of Commandant (medical) Dr G M Sharma, Assistant Commandant Vimal Gupta, team commander inspector Sunil Kumar Shanti along with 38 personnel of the 12th Battalion of NDRF.
RK Mission Secretary Swami Viswesnananda Maharaj, doctors, Para medical and officials including attendants of the patient and locals in large numbers were present on the occasion.
